The Opportunity:
The Early Help Intervention Lead plays a vital role in supporting pupils and families at the earliest stage of concern. This position involves leading the school’s Early Help offer, delivering targeted interventions, and coordinating multi-agency support to improve student outcomes.
Key Responsibilities:
- Provide targeted support to manage the school's early help processes
- Act as the main point of contact for early help referrals within the school community
- Advise senior leadership in the production and implementation of whole school strategies to improve pupil behaviour
- Manage the delivery of targeted 1:1 and group interventions
- Coordinate multi-agency support to address emerging needs promptly
- Contribute to safeguarding, attendance, behaviour, and wellbeing initiatives
- Ensure early identification and timely addressing of student needs
- Support the development of effective early help plans and initiatives
